Output e2eb80c4ca7de16053e980bc1c66b66f3239fc6a4bf4b53c1e0fe8101da7a482:0

value
140588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fae3ba4a7bb6cac5cca5e86a97bf2e8ec94774d2 OP_EQUAL
address
3QZbfJK2d4uAc9TP3qETWVSJ7DAoCDYkpC
transaction
e2eb80c4ca7de16053e980bc1c66b66f3239fc6a4bf4b53c1e0fe8101da7a482
spent
true